SY_LagUmbuchung
- lk
- dw
Owned by lk
Führt eine ungeplante Umbuchung für einen Artikel durch.
Prototype
SY_LagUmbuchung(ArtikelNr,LagerNrAb,LagerortAb,LagerplatzAb,ChargeAb,BehaelterNrAb,LagerNrZu,LagerortZu,LagerplatzZu,ChargeZu,BehaelterNrZu,BewMenge,BelegNr,Bemerkung)
Parameter
Parameter | Typ | Bedeutung |
---|---|---|
ArtikelNr | string | Zu buchende Artikel-Nr. |
LagerNrAb | number | Abgangs-Lager-Nr. |
LagerortAb | string | Abgangs-Lagerort |
LagerplatzAb | string | Abgangs-Lagerplatz |
ChargeAb | string | Abgangs-Chargen-Nr. |
BehaelterNrAb | string | Abgangs-Behaelter-Nr. |
LagerNrZu | number | Zugangs-Lager-Nr. |
LagerortZu | string | Zugangs-Lagerort |
LagerplatzZu | string | Zugangs-Lagerplatz |
ChargeZu | string | Zugangs-Chargen-Nr. |
BehaelterNrZu | string | Zugangs-Behaelter-Nr. |
BewMenge | number | Zu buchende Menge |
BelegNr | string | Beleg-Nr. |
Bemerkung | string | Bemerkung |
Hinweise
- Die Funktion ist aus Gründen der Rückwärtskompatibilität auch unter dem Namen
EX_LagUmbuchung
verfügbar. - Werden für die Funktionsargumente ungültige Typen gewählt, löst dies einen Laufzeitfehler aus.
- Wenn ein Fehler beim Buchen auftritt, dann löst dies einen Laufzeitfehler aus (nur syslog.ERP 5).
Beispiel
-- ungeplante Umbuchen SY_LagUmbuchung( "150222", -- Artikel-Nr. '150222' 0, "fli", "", "", "", -- von Lager-Nr. 0, Lagerort 'fli', Lagerplatz blank, Chargen-Nr. blank, Behälter-Nr. blank 0, "flr", "", "", "", -- nach Lager-Nr. 0, Lagerort 'flr', Lagerplatz blank, Chargen-Nr. blank, Behälter-Nr. blank 250, -- Menge 250 "2", -- Beleg-Nr. '2' "Umbuchung aus LUA" ); -- Bemerkung 'Umbuchung aus LUA'